    Holden Monaro

    Rob yes it did look great in the red but I couldn't find that red paint again and me not being a GM man blasted it with green and George it ain't a GTO if U lok carefully U'll see the grille/bumper at the front and the bumper at the rear is completely different our Holden Monaro was sent to the U.S.rebadged a GTO when they didn't sell in the land of the YankTank (Aussie term) G.M. Holden brought them back to Oz converted them back to right hook and sold them as it, we have quite a few rebadged GTO's as Monaros now with all the GTO gear pn them. So that's why this model is right hook it's is actually a Monaro not a GTO. Dingo
